This detached house is located in CIRENCESTER, GL7 5QB. The property offers 252m² (2713 sq ft) of generously-sized living space with 10 habitable rooms. It is a characterful interwar or early 20th century home. The property has an EPC rating of E (47/100), which is below average but still meets minimum rental requirements. With recommended improvements, it could achieve a C rating (79/100). The gas central heating system has good efficiency, indicating a relatively modern, well-maintained boiler. The property has good loft insulation, though topping up to the recommended 270mm depth could provide additional energy savings. Double glazing is installed, though the efficiency rating suggests older units. Modern low-E double glazing can be up to 40% more efficient than units installed before 2002. Estimated annual energy costs are £2497, comprising £2190 for heating, £142 for hot water, and £165 for lighting. The property produces 12.0 tonnes of CO2 per year, which is high for a UK home.

About this EPC: Energy Performance Certificates are valid for 10 years and are required when a property is built, sold, or rented.
